Detroit 4, St. Louis 1
Matt Vierling belted a two-run home run as part of a three-RBI performance and the host Detroit Tigers defeated the St. Louis Cardinals 4-1 on Wednesday afternoon.
Milwaukee 7, Tampa Bay 1
Milwaukee's Willy Adames belted two home runs and drove in four runs and Colin Rea pitched six shutout innings as the Brewers defeated visiting Tampa Bay, 7-1, in the final meeting of a three-game series on Wednesday afternoon.

Minnesota 10, Chi. White Sox 5
Jose Miranda and Willi Castro had three hits apiece and Alex Kirilloff homered as the Minnesota Twins defeated the host Chicago White Sox 10-5 on Wednesday afternoon, extending their winning streak to 10 games.

Kansas City 6, Toronto 1
Michael Massey hit a three-run homer, right-hander Seth Lugo allowed two hits over seven innings and the visiting Kansas City Royals defeated the Toronto Blue Jays 6-1 on Wednesday afternoon.

Oakland 4, Pittsburgh 0
Ross Stripling won for the first time since 2022, Abraham Toro and Tyler Nevin hit home runs and the Oakland Athletics completed a three-game sweep of the visiting Pittsburgh Pirates with a 4-0 victory Wednesday afternoon.

Atlanta 5, Seattle 2
Austin Riley hit a two-run triple and Chris Sale allowed one run over five innings as the Atlanta Braves salvaged the finale of a three-game interleague series in Seattle, defeating the host Mariners 5-2 on Wednesday afternoon.

Philadelphia 2, LA Angels 1
Kyle Schwarber had two singles and two RBIs to lift the Philadelphia Phillies past the Los Angeles Angels 2-1 on Wednesday in Anaheim, Calif.

San Diego 6, Cincinnati 2
Jake Cronenworth hit a tiebreaking grand slam in the seventh inning to help the San Diego Padres win the rubber contest of the three-game series 6-2 against the visiting Cincinnati Reds on Wednesday afternoon.

NY Yankees 2, Baltimore 0
Luis Gil pitched 6 1/3 innings and Oswaldo Cabrera hit a two-run home run as the New York Yankees beat the host Baltimore Orioles 2-0 on Wednesday.

Miami 4, Colorado 1
Emmanuel Rivera had two hits and scored twice and the host Miami Marlins beat the Colorado Rockies 4-1 on Wednesday night to win consecutive games for the first time this season.

Chi. Cubs 1, NY Mets 0
Rookie Shota Imanaga had another strong start and Pete Crow-Armstrong hit a tiebreaking sacrifice fly in the fifth inning Wednesday night as the visiting Chicago Cubs beat the New York Mets 1-0.

Boston 6, San Francisco 2
Kutter Crawford threw a career-high seven innings and Connor Wong went 3-for-4 with two doubles as the host Boston Red Sox eased past the San Francisco Giants, 6-2, on Wednesday.

Washington 1, Texas 0
Trevor Williams and four relievers combined on a six-hit shutout as the Washington Nationals beat the Texas Rangers 1-0 on Wednesday in Arlington, Texas.

Cleveland 3, Houston 2
Steven Kwan hit an RBI double in the top of the 10th inning before Emmanuel Clase recorded his ninth save as the visiting Cleveland Guardians squeezed out a 3-2 victory over the Houston Astros on Wednesday.

LA Dodgers 8, Arizona 0
Yoshinobu Yamamoto threw six scoreless innings to help lead the Los Angeles Dodgers to an 8-0 win over the Arizona Diamondbacks on Wednesday in Phoenix.
